在建筑行业数字化转型加速的今天,施工图片识别软件正成为提升工地管理效率、保障施工安全的关键工具。那么,施工图片识别软件究竟是如何打造的?它背后的技术原理是什么?又该如何落地应用?本文将从技术架构、核心功能、实施步骤到实际案例,全面解析施工图片识别软件的开发与应用路径。
一、为什么需要施工图片识别软件?
传统施工现场依赖人工巡查和纸质记录,存在效率低、易遗漏、响应慢等问题。据《中国建筑业发展报告》显示,超过60%的安全事故源于现场违规行为未被及时发现。而施工图片识别软件通过AI视觉分析技术,能够自动识别人员着装、设备状态、环境隐患等关键信息,实现全天候、无死角的智能监控。
1. 提升安全管理效率
软件可自动识别是否佩戴安全帽、反光衣、高空作业是否系安全带等,一旦发现违规行为立即告警,大幅降低事故发生率。例如,某大型桥梁项目引入该系统后,安全违规事件下降75%,整改响应时间从平均4小时缩短至30分钟。
2. 优化进度与质量控制
通过图像比对施工阶段与计划是否一致,如钢筋绑扎是否达标、混凝土浇筑是否规范,辅助项目管理人员快速发现问题,减少返工成本。某住宅楼项目利用该技术,在模板拆除前发现两处结构偏差,避免了重大质量问题。
3. 实现数据驱动决策
所有识别结果形成结构化数据,支持生成日报、周报、月报,为管理层提供可视化报表,助力科学决策。同时,历史数据可用于趋势分析,预测潜在风险点。
二、施工图片识别软件的核心技术组成
一套成熟的施工图片识别软件通常由以下几个模块构成:
1. 图像采集层
- 多源接入:支持摄像头(固定/移动)、无人机航拍、工人手持终端等多种设备上传图片或视频流。
- 边缘计算:在前端部署轻量级模型,实现实时预处理和初步筛选,减少云端压力。
2. AI识别引擎
- 目标检测:基于YOLO、Faster R-CNN等算法,精准定位画面中的人、车、物、危险区域。
- 图像分类:判断场景类别(如基坑开挖、脚手架搭建)及行为类别(如攀爬、吸烟)。
- OCR识别:提取施工日志、标识牌文字信息,辅助合规性检查。
- 语义分割:区分不同材质表面(如水泥、钢筋),用于质量评估。
3. 数据处理与存储
- 标准化处理:统一格式、分辨率、色彩空间,提高识别准确率。
- 数据库设计:采用MySQL+Redis组合,兼顾事务完整性与高频读取性能。
- 云原生架构:支持弹性扩容,适应大规模项目并发需求。
4. 可视化与报警系统
- Web端仪表盘:展示实时识别结果、热力图、异常分布情况。
- 移动端推送:微信小程序/APP推送告警信息,确保责任人第一时间响应。
- 规则引擎:允许用户自定义告警阈值(如连续3次未戴安全帽触发警报)。
三、开发流程详解:从需求到上线
一个完整的施工图片识别软件开发周期可分为五个阶段:
1. 需求调研与场景定义
需深入工地一线,与项目经理、安全员、监理沟通,明确哪些问题最迫切需要解决。常见应用场景包括:
- 安全帽佩戴识别
- 高空作业防护措施检查
- 材料堆放合规性判断
- 临时用电线路是否存在私拉乱接
- 消防器材位置是否被遮挡
2. 数据采集与标注
这是决定模型效果的关键环节。需收集至少10万张高质量施工图片(含白天/夜间、晴天/雨天、不同角度),并进行专业标注:
- 框选目标物体(如人、车辆、设备)
- 打标签(如“违规操作”、“正常施工”)
- 标注细节(如安全帽颜色、是否正确佩戴)
建议使用LabelImg、CVAT等开源工具,并邀请一线工人参与审核,确保标注真实可信。
3. 模型训练与优化
选用主流深度学习框架(如PyTorch、TensorFlow)进行训练:
- 基础模型选择:YOLOv8适合实时检测,ResNet50适合细粒度分类
- 迁移学习:利用ImageNet预训练权重加快收敛速度
- 增强策略:随机裁剪、亮度调整、模糊模拟,提升泛化能力
- 迭代优化:每轮训练后测试集准确率应稳步提升,目标达到95%以上
4. 系统集成与测试
将训练好的模型封装为API服务,对接前端界面与数据库:
- 前后端分离架构(Vue + Flask/Django)
- 接口设计遵循RESTful规范,便于扩展
- 压力测试:模拟百路摄像头并发访问,验证系统稳定性
- 用户体验测试:邀请安全员试用一周,收集反馈改进交互逻辑
5. 上线部署与运维
推荐采用容器化部署(Docker + Kubernetes),便于跨平台迁移:
- 本地服务器部署(适用于小型项目)
- 私有云部署(适用于集团型企业)
- 公有云部署(如阿里云、华为云,适合异地项目联动)
上线后持续监控模型性能,定期更新训练数据以应对新工况。
四、典型应用场景与成功案例
以下是几个已在实践中验证有效的应用场景:
1. 安全帽识别——某地铁站项目
该项目共有120名工人,每日约产生3000张现场照片。系统自动识别未佩戴安全帽的情况,每天平均发现15起违规,告警推送至班组长手机端,整改率达98%。项目周期内零安全事故。
2. 脚手架搭设合规性检查——某高层住宅工程
通过对比施工图纸与现场图片,AI能识别脚手架间距过大、缺少连墙件等问题,提前预警可能坍塌风险。项目部据此调整施工方案,节省材料费用约12万元。
3. 材料堆放管理——某工业园区厂房建设
系统自动识别钢材、模板等材料是否按规划区域堆放,防止占用通道或引发火灾隐患。管理员可通过后台一键生成整改清单,极大提升工作效率。
五、面临的挑战与未来趋势
尽管前景广阔,施工图片识别软件仍面临以下挑战:
1. 复杂环境干扰
扬尘、强光、雨雾等恶劣天气会影响图像质量,导致误判。解决方案包括红外成像融合、多模态感知(结合雷达、激光雷达)。
2. 小样本问题
某些特殊工种(如爆破作业)样本稀缺,难以训练出高精度模型。可借助GAN生成对抗网络合成多样化样本。
3. 隐私与合规风险
涉及人脸、车牌等敏感信息时,必须遵守《个人信息保护法》。建议对人脸做模糊处理,仅保留行为特征用于识别。
4. 向AI+IoT融合演进
未来将与智能穿戴设备(如安全帽内置摄像头)、无人机巡检、BIM模型联动,构建“数字孪生工地”,实现全流程智能化管控。
总之,施工图片识别软件不仅是技术工具,更是推动建筑行业向精益化、智慧化转型的重要抓手。随着算法进步与硬件普及,其应用边界将持续拓展,真正让工地更安全、更高效、更透明。
如果你正在寻找一款可靠且易于部署的施工图片识别解决方案,不妨试试蓝燕云提供的AI图像识别平台:蓝燕云。该平台提供免费试用版本,支持多种场景定制,无需代码即可快速搭建属于你的智能工地管理系统!